Manufacturers hit with average 3% rise in input costs

Producers in the Manufacturing industry faced an average three  per cent rise in costs associated with delivering inputs on an annual basis as at May.
 
The Statistical Institute of Jamaica has attributed this to a 13 per cent increase in the average cost of Refined Petroleum Products and a 1.2% upward movement in costs associated with Food, Beverages & Tobacco.
 
For the month of May alone, STATIN reported a 0.8?cline in the cost of Refined Petroleum Products.
 
There was however a 0.1% increase in prices faced by producers in the heaviest weighted major group, Food, Beverages & Tobacco.
